The official death toll from the recent double earthquake in Venezuela has risen to 5,069, according to authorities. In addition to the fatalities, reports indicate 16,740 people have been injured and nearly 18,000 are without homes due to the devastation. Approximately 190 buildings have completely collapsed as a result of the seismic events. Authorities state that over 128,000 families have received assistance, though ongoing needs remain significant. Rescue and relief efforts are continuing as the nation grapples with the scale of the disaster. Further details are expected as assessments are completed.
